I've attached a shell script which will fix some paths in the
Makefile.am's. This will allow VPATH to work so that you can build out
of the source tree. It's not an obtrusive change (usually doesn't take
much to fix them). It's kinda handy when you're building for multiple
architectures. You don't have to "make clean", just delete your build
dir when your done.
cd builddir
../pathtosource/configure
make

#! /bin/bash
libeventVPATHPatcher() {
# Fix paths that break VPATH
if [[ ! -f 'Makefile.am.orig' ]]; then
cp -p 'Makefile.am' 'Makefile.am.orig'
ed 'Makefile.am' <<END
/-Icompat/
s#-Icompat#-I\$(srcdir)/compat#p
/make verify/
s#\$(srcdir)/##p
wq
END
fi
pushd 'sample'
if [[ ! -f 'Makefile.am.orig' ]]; then
cp -p 'Makefile.am' 'Makefile.am.orig'
ed 'Makefile.am' <<END
/CPPFPLAGS/
.d
i
CPPFLAGS = -I\$(top_srcdir)
.
/CFLAGS/
.d
i
CFLAGS = -I\$(top_srcdir)/compat
.
wq
END
fi
popd
pushd 'test'
if [[ ! -f 'Makefile.am.orig' ]]; then
cp -p 'Makefile.am' 'Makefile.am.orig'
ed 'Makefile.am' <<END
/CPPFPLAGS =/
.d
i
CPPFLAGS = -I\$(top_srcdir)
.
/CFLAGS =/
.d
i
CFLAGS = -I\$(top_srcdir)/compat
.
/event_rpcgen.py/
s/..\/event_rpcgen.py/\$(top_srcdir)\/event_rpcgen.py/p
wq
END
fi
popd
automake # generate new Makefile.in's
}
libeventVPATHPatcher
